ADF and Scanner section size detection

$
0
0
Hi guys and gals,

I just looked at a C284 (non 'e' version) that was exhibiting some strange behaviour.

The symptoms were;

Placing an A4 document on the feed tray yielded an error message stating Original on Glass. Remove Original.
Placing an A4 portrait size sheet on glass; Machine detects A3.
Placing an A4 Landscape size sheet on glass; Machine detects 81/2 x 14".

I'm located in Australia, and we don't use those weird sizes. At the moment the issue is gone.

What I decided I would try was to set this particular setting; [Service Mode] > [System 1] > [Original Size Detection] and change Copy Glass from Table 2 to Table 1. Instantly the problem disappeared. By default it looks like Table 2 is the default for Australia (according to the myriad of C284e's in my office.)

My question/s is/are:

Is there any adverse effects to changing the size detection table to 1?
Is there a copy of either Table to look at?

I've searched through the Service and Theory manuals, but all I can make sense of is this:

(1) Copy Glass
(a) Use

  • To change the size detection table for document glass.


(b) Default Setting

  • The default setting varies depending on marketing area.


(c)Setting item

  • Table 1
  • Table 2

NOTE

  • Table 2 can be set only when original size sensor 2 is being mounted.

It has the second size sensor installed from what I can see. (2 black rectangular boxes with a small dome shaped sensor at the rear right section of scanner.

Firmware is G20-66. Currently downloading the most recent firmware, but on the work internet connection, downloading anything sizeable takes 1.5 hours or more.
